Queensland Parliament will be overflowing with the region’s iconic products as local MPs Stephen Bennett and Tom Smith host an exclusive roadshow event to celebrate all things Bundaberg and Burnett.

The highly-anticipated eighth annual Bundaberg Region Promotion Night will showcase the region’s finest produce, attractions and award-winning businesses all under one roof in our state’s capital city.

The region will be well-represented with the likes of Bundaberg Rum, Bundaberg Fruit and Vegetable Growers, Kalki Moon, CRUSH, Splitters Farm, Tinaberries and local chamber of commerce groups all making a special appearance.

Member for Burnett Stephen Bennett, who first launched the event in 2012, said he was proud to once again bring the region’s unbeatable produce and unique tourism opportunities and thriving organisations to Brisbane.

Another business joining the event this year is Ballistic Beer Co, which brews award winning craft beers in Bundaberg, Brisbane and the Whitsundays using fresh local ingredients.

The bi-partisan event will be held on Thursday, June 17 at Parliament House.
